What does the word "Cachepot" mean?

The term "cachepot" refers to a decorative container used to hold a plant pot, providing an aesthetic appeal while protecting surfaces from water damage. The word originates from the French "cacher," meaning "to hide," and "pot," which directly translates to "pot." Together, these elements highlight the cachepot's primary function: to conceal the often plain or utilitarian styles of standard plant pots while allowing for the greenery inside to thrive.

Cachepots come in various materials, shapes, and sizes, making them a popular choice among gardeners and interior decorators alike. Their purpose extends beyond mere aesthetics; they also serve practical functions. Here are some key points about cachepots:

When selecting a cachepot, consider the size of the plant and the pot it will hold. It is essential to choose a cachepot that allows for some airflow and does not trap excess moisture, as this could lead to root rot. Additionally, cachepots should be aesthetically pleasing and complement your home or garden's overall style.
